How to SET UP the CAA RECORD on your domain
The CAA type record serves to authorize the SSL certificate authority (the security certificate for pages) to generate certificates for a given domain.
If there is any CAA type record registered on your domain, you will also need to have the authorization record for the certificate authority Sectigo (the company that provides this service to us) so that we can generate the certificates for your pages.
Therefore, go into your domain management panel (DNS zone) and check whether there is any "CAA" type record.
If there is one, and it does not contain the name "sectigo" in the record data, you will need to follow the guidelines below:
- Click to add a new DNS Record;
- Select the record type as "CAA";
- To fill in the fields, use the guidelines below as a reference:

Keep in mind that each DNS management panel has different guidelines, as well as different names for the fields. Therefore, the tutorial above may change according to the platform you are accessing.
